重庆安菲云新闻中心

关注互联网,关注技术开发,透析与分享移动互联网行业最新动态

主页 > 新闻中心 > 行业资讯 > 开发微信小程序外卖

李经理

15年全栈工程师

重庆安菲云技术负责人

15年APP开发经验、精通JAVA框架

360

开发案例

795

已咨询人数

开发微信小程序外卖

时间:2024-12-23 22:19:00来源:安菲云科技阅读:241223
开发微信小程序外卖的步骤开发微信小程序外卖系统是一个系统化的过程,通常包括以下几个关键步骤:需求分析在开发之前,首先需要明确外卖小程序的功能需求,包括用户端和商家端的功能,如订单管理、支付系统等。设计界面设计小程序的用户界面和交互流程,确保用户能够方便地进行注册、浏览菜单、下单和支付。后端开发搭建服

开发微信小程序外卖的步骤

开发微信小程序外卖系统是一个系统化的过程,通常包括以下几个关键步骤:

  1. 需求分析
    在开发之前,首先需要明确外卖小程序的功能需求,包括用户端和商家端的功能,如订单管理、支付系统等。

  2. 设计界面
    设计小程序的用户界面和交互流程,确保用户能够方便地进行注册、浏览菜单、下单和支付。

  3. 后端开发
    搭建服务器和数据库,开发后端功能以处理用户请求和商家信息。常用的技术包括Java和Spring Boot框架,数据库则可以使用MySQL。

  4. 前端开发
    使用前端技术(如HTML、CSS、JavaScript)开发小程序的界面和交互逻辑,确保用户体验流畅。

  5. 测试
    对开发完成的外卖小程序进行功能测试、兼容性测试和性能测试,确保其稳定性和安全性。

  6. 发布与推广
    将外卖小程序发布到微信平台,并进行推广,以吸引更多用户使用。

开发微信小程序外卖的详细步骤

1. 需求分析

在开发外卖小程序之前,进行详细的需求分析是至关重要的。这一阶段需要明确小程序的目标用户、核心功能和市场定位。通常,外卖小程序需要具备以下功能:

  • 用户注册与登录
  • 菜单浏览与搜索
  • 订单下单与支付
  • 订单状态跟踪
  • 用户评价与反馈

2. 界面设计

界面设计是用户体验的关键。设计师需要创建一个直观、易用的界面,确保用户能够轻松找到所需功能。设计过程中,可以使用原型工具(如Axure或Figma)来模拟用户交互流程,并进行用户测试以收集反馈。

3. 后端开发

后端开发是实现小程序核心功能的基础。开发者需要搭建服务器,通常使用云服务(如腾讯云或阿里云)来托管应用。后端开发涉及以下几个方面:

  • 数据库设计:设计数据库结构以存储用户信息、订单数据和菜品信息。MySQL是常用的关系型数据库。

  • API开发:开发RESTful API以供前端调用,处理用户请求和数据交互。

  • 安全性:确保数据传输的安全性,使用HTTPS协议,并对用户数据进行加密处理。

4. 前端开发

前端开发是用户直接交互的部分。开发者需要使用微信开发者工具进行小程序的开发。前端开发的关键技术包括:

  • 小程序框架:使用微信小程序框架进行开发,利用其提供的组件和API快速构建界面。

  • 响应式设计:确保小程序在不同设备上的良好显示效果。

  • 用户体验优化:通过优化加载速度和交互响应时间,提高用户体验。

5. 测试

测试是确保小程序质量的重要环节。开发团队需要进行多轮测试,包括:

  • 功能测试:验证每个功能模块是否按预期工作。

  • 兼容性测试:确保小程序在不同版本的微信和不同设备上均能正常运行。

  • 性能测试:评估小程序在高并发情况下的表现,确保其稳定性。

6. 发布与推广

完成开发和测试后,开发者可以将小程序提交到微信平台进行审核。审核通过后,小程序将正式上线。为了吸引用户,可以通过以下方式进行推广:

  • 社交媒体营销:利用微信朋友圈、公众号等渠道进行宣传。

  • 优惠活动:推出首单优惠、满减活动等吸引用户下单。

  • 用户反馈:鼓励用户评价和反馈,以不断优化小程序功能和用户体验。

深度扩展:微信小程序外卖的市场前景与挑战

随着移动互联网的快速发展,外卖服务已成为人们日常生活中不可或缺的一部分。微信小程序作为一种轻量级的应用形式,凭借其便捷性和高效性,迅速在外卖市场中占据了一席之地。

市场前景

  1. 用户需求增长
    随着生活节奏的加快,越来越多的消费者倾向于选择外卖服务。根据市场研究,外卖行业的市场规模持续扩大,预计未来几年将保持高速增长。

  2. 技术进步
    微信小程序的技术不断更新,提供了更多的功能和服务,如在线支付、实时订单追踪等,提升了用户体验。

  3. 生态系统完善
    微信生态系统的完善使得小程序能够更好地与其他服务(如公众号、支付等)整合,形成闭环,增强用户粘性。

面临的挑战

  1. 竞争激烈
    外卖市场竞争异常激烈,众多平台和小程序争夺用户,开发者需要不断创新以保持竞争力。

  2. 用户留存难
    吸引用户下单相对容易,但留住用户却是一个长期挑战。开发者需要通过优质的服务和用户体验来提高用户的忠诚度。

  3. 技术维护
    随着用户量的增加,系统的稳定性和安全性变得尤为重要。开发者需要定期进行系统维护和更新,以应对潜在的技术问题。

结论

开发微信小程序外卖系统不仅是一个技术挑战,更是一个市场机会。通过合理的需求分析、精心的设计和高效的开发流程,开发者可以创建出符合市场需求的外卖小程序。同时,面对激烈的市场竞争,持续的创新和用户体验优化将是成功的关键。

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!
重庆APP定制开发公司

上一篇:开发微信小程序实战

下一篇:开发微信小程序图片

最新新闻

相关推荐

立即联系 售前产品经理

电话沟通

微信咨询